After being hit by a strange quirk, Izuku finds himself holding two white-haired brothers who claim to be from the past. When All for One takes an inexplicable interest in the time-travelers, All Might volunteers to protect the adorable brothers.

OR: All for One loses his shit after his younger self and his long-dead brother travel forward in time and get adopted by All Might.

[[https://archiveofourown.org/works/33559921/chapters/83389528 Forgiveness is the Attribute of the Strong]] is an Alternate Universe My Hero Academia fanfic written by [[https://archiveofourown.org/users/katydid/pseuds/katydid katydid]] / [[https://www.fanfiction.net/u/1109140/chibikaty chibikaty]].
----

!! Forgiveness is the Attribute of the Strong contains examples of:

* AccidentalTimeTravel: The fic starts with eleven-year-old All for One and his little brother accidentally traveling forward in time to the canon time period.

* AdaptationalHeroism: The younger version of Hisashi/All for One is heading in this direction.

* AdultFear: Toshinori when he realizes that[[spoiler:both of his adopted kids, Hisashi and Yoichi, have been kidnapped and attacked by Stain.]]

* AlternateTimeline: This story diverges when Small for One and young First travel forward in time. This story uses the parallel universe version of time travel, so their older selves are also around (as a vestige in the case of the latter.)

* AnnoyingYoungerSibling: Young Yoichi teases his older brother mercilessly about his crushes.

* BerserkButton: Threating one brother triggers this in the other one.

* BigBrotherInstinct: Young Hisashi is a very overprotective older brother. So was All for One in the flashbacks, although that went terribly wrong by the end.
